The highest-performing public elementary schools in science in Union County, New Jersey

Across Union County, New Jersey, 78 public elementary schools are ranked here, ranked by the share of students meeting or exceeding the state science standard. Salt Brook School leads the list at 80.5%, against a median of 15.4% across the ranked schools.
